Authorities in Escambia County have arrested Seveyon DaQuon Richardson, ending a standoff that prompted a significant law enforcement response. Richardson faces multiple charges, and the Sheriff's Office is providing updates as the investigation continues.

Escambia County Sheriff's Office Announces End of Standoff, Suspect in Custody. The tense situation that unfolded in Escambia County has concluded with the apprehension of Seveyon DaQuon Richardson, 34. Following a standoff that prompted a significant law enforcement presence and public caution, authorities successfully took Richardson into custody.

The Escambia County Sheriff's Office (ECSO) confirmed the resolution of the incident, expressing gratitude for the cooperation of the community and the dedication of the officers involved. Details regarding the exact location of the standoff have not been fully disclosed at this time, but the ECSO had earlier urged residents to steer clear of the area, advising them to utilize alternate routes while the situation was active. The community can rest assured that public safety remains the top priority of the Sheriff's Office.\Seveyon DaQuon Richardson faces a litany of charges stemming from outstanding warrants and items found during the incident. The charges include burglary and damage to property, multiple counts of criminal mischief, firing a weapon, aggravated battery, weapon offense, and possession of a weapon by a convicted felon, as confirmed by the ECSO. The authorities have emphasized the severity of Richardson's past criminal behavior. Richardson’s extensive criminal history paints a concerning picture of repeat offenses and a pattern of disregarding the law. The ECSO reports that Richardson has a history encompassing numerous misdemeanor and felony convictions. The charges include, but are not limited to, battery, theft, burglary, aggravated assault, aggravated battery, fleeing and eluding, drug offenses, and weapon violations.
